My level : Coral Sea
Before deciding on which marine organism to use as the base prototype, I believe I need to first understand the characteristics of the Coral Sea. After researching relevant materials, I have learned that the Coral Sea is a colorful kingdom of corals, tropical fish and large marine creatures: vibrant corals form habitats, clownfish, butterflyfish and parrotfish adorn the coral reefs, while whale sharks, sea turtles and orcas swim among them, constituting one of the richest marine ecosystems on Earth.
While researching the general marine life in the Coral Sea, I became particularly interested in seahorses. Therefore, I have decided to base my series of creations on seahorses and incorporate new design elements.
My 2D design
I was also deeply interested in creatures such as leafy seadragon. As close relatives of seahorses, they do not naturally live in the Coral Sea. However, their unique appearance has sparked abundant creative inspiration for me. Their bodies are covered with translucent leaf‑like skin appendages resembling seaweed, which are their most distinctive feature, and the horn‑like protrusions on their heads look like twigs. Since the creature I am designing is supposed to inhabit the Coral Sea, I added two coral‑shaped tentacles to the head of my seahorse‑based creature in my sketches.
